150 Individuals in Attendance at Osaka University Leaders Forum in Tokyo

On Tuesday, February 14, the Osaka University Leaders Forum was held at Gakushi-Kaikan in Tokyo with more than 150 individuals in attendance.
This forum is held each year in order for graduates of Osaka University and Osaka University of Foreign Studies currently active on the front lines of their respective fields, as well as current faculty and students of Osaka University, to strengthen relationships with one another. This year, the forum, now in its 5th year, was held in Tokyo for the first time.

The forum began with a greeting from President NISHIO Shojiro in which he talked about recent events at Osaka University. This greeting was followed by an introduction to the university's endeavors in industry-university collaboration by Executive Vice President YOSHIKAWA Hideki.

Later, Prof. YANAGIDA Toshio (Director, Center for Information and Neural Networks/Specially Appointed Professor, Graduate School of Frontier Biosciences) delivered a lecture entitled "Unraveling the Brain and AI through Fluctuations," in which he talked about the latest in research on the working of the human brain and AI lead by fluctuations, all while including a bit of humor and speaking in a manner that was easy to understand.

A toast from SAKAMOTO Hiroko (1981 graduate, School of Letters) kicked off the social event, in which attendees deepened friendships beyond generations and fields, making for an energetic event.
